Arginine (in Amino Blend)
An amino acid is the building block of proteins. Arginine is produced naturally in the body. It is also found in foods such as red meat, poultry, fish, dairy products, eggs, and all types of seeds. Arginine helps dilate, or open, blood vessels. It works by converting into nitric oxide in the body. Nitric oxide then dilates the blood vessels by relaxing the muscles that constrict them. It can stimulate the release of insulin, growth hormone (which helps increase muscle mass and reduce body fat), and other substances. It may also help with athletic performance, kidney function following a transplant, preeclampsia, inflammation in the digestive tract of premature infants, and immune system function.
L-Proline (in Amino Blend)
L-Proline (In Amino Blend) is an amino acid. Amino acids are the building blocks of proteins. Proline is made naturally within the body, and it is consumed in our daily diet. It is found in protein-rich foods such as meat, fish, and dairy products. Our bodies use proline to make proteins such as collagen. Collagen is found within the skin, bones, and joints. Proline is commonly used for skin healing, especially in those with a proline deficiency. Proline plays important roles in protein production and structure, metabolism, and arginine synthesis. It may also be helpful for wound healing, antioxidative reactions, and immune responses. It may help maintain muscle tissue after long, vigorous workouts.
Lysine (in Amino Blend)
One of the nine essential amino acids in the human body, which act as the building blocks of proteins. Lysine is necessary to healthy growth and plays an essential role in the production of carnitine, which is critical to several processes in the human body, including healthy heart and brain function. Since the body cannot synthesize lysine, adequate levels of the amino acid must be obtained from dietary sources and supplementation. Good dietary sources of lysine are protein-rich foods such as eggs, meat (specifically red meat, lamb, pork, and poultry), soy, beans, peas, cheese (particularly Parmesan), and certain fish (such as cod and sardines). Lysine may be used for athletic performance, symptoms of diabetes, managing symptoms of the herpes virus (cold sores), and more. It can significantly increase the amount of circulating of growth hormones. This has led to athletes using lysine as a means of promoting muscle growth while training. L-lysine also helps the body to absorb calcium. Because of this, it is also used in the treatment of osteoporosis. Its use has been suggested for diabetes, stress, and improved athletic performance. Lysine is a precursor of carnitine. It may also help the body absorb calcium and form collagen.
Biotin (Vitamin B7)
Biotin (B7): also known as vitamin B7, is a nutrient found across a variety of natural sources. Most commonly found in foods including bananas, fish, and eggs, it helps enzymes break down fatty acids and amino acids to support the production of energy. This vitamin is commonly used in regimens designed around hair, skin, and nail health.
Calcium
Calcium helps to regulate the levels of other minerals in the body. This makes it an important part of keeping the body functioning properly. Calcium is the fifth most abundant element in the body, and it is the major component of your bones. Calcium is essential to the function of our nervous and muscular systems, the coagulation of blood, and for normal contractility of the heart. Calcium also affects the secretory activity of endocrine and exocrine glands. It helps restore altered serum calcium levels caused by fluctuating estrogen levels, which can relieve muscle cramps and help correct serotonin dysregulation to improve irritability. Calcium Chloride acts as an electrolyte, helping your body maintain fluid through activities, and helps you maintain proper muscle and nerve functioning. Calcium chloride also helps to maintain bone health and prevent muscle spasms.
NAD+: (short for nicotinamide adenine dinucleotide)
NAD+: (short for nicotinamide adenine dinucleotide) is a coenzyme naturally produced by the body. When naturally occurring, it plays a role in energy production, metabolism, and DNA repair. It is probably the most important co-factor for improving mitochondrial function. Mitochondria are intracellular organelles (AKA “energy powerhouses”) where micronutrients are converted to energy-rich ATP molecules for the cell. As we age, our body’s NAD levels gradually drop due to lower intrinsic production and inflammation/oxidative stress caused by environmental factors. This drop in NAD+ can cause fatigue, mental fog, dull and tired skin, and poor sleep quality. Boosting NAD+ may help manage a wide spectrum of diseases and the effects of aging. Due to its role in the body, NAD+ has been observed for its role in supporting healthy aging. Research has shown that NAD+ may have potential for fighting the effects of addiction. Excessive alcohol and drug use diminishes the amount of NAD naturally found in the body; by reintroducing it through NAD therapy, cravings and withdrawal effects may be reduced as a result. Additionally, NAD+ has been shown to boost serotonin, aiding with symptoms brought on by depression and anxiety.
Alpha Lipoic Acid (ALA)
Alpha Lipoic Acid (ALA) is a fatty acid that occurs naturally in the body. ALA is often referred to as the “universal antioxidant.” It supports vital functions at the cellular level, such as producing energy and protecting your cells from damage. The body has the ability to produce ALA. It is also found in dietary sources, such as red meat, organ meat (liver, heart, kidney, etc.), broccoli, tomatoes, spinach, brussels sprouts, and yeast. Once administered, ALA is readily absorbed and distributed throughout all major organs. Other Uses Alpha lipoic acid strengthens the body’s defenses by recycling and enhancing other antioxidants in the body, such as vitamins C and E, coenzyme Q10, and glutathione. ALA works in the mitochondria and is a vital part of the conversion of glucose to energy. Glucose requires insulin to get into cells. ALA mimics insulin, improving both glucose metabolism and insulin sensitivity. This simply means that more glucose is transported into the cells rather than being stored as fat. ALA also improves the conversion of carbohydrates to energy, which reduces the amounts available to be converted to fats. It is also required for formation of collagen and keratin, stimulates hair follicle, & improves skin elasticity and reduces wrinkles.
L-Taurine (Taurine)
L-Taurine (Taurine) is a conditionally essential amino acid. Unlike most amino acids, taurine doesn’t play a role in building proteins. It helps to maintain proper hydration and electrolyte and mineral balance in your cells, supporting the functions of the digestive, nervous, and immune systems. It enhances mental performance, reduces fatigue, & enhances exercise performance. It reduces inflammation, limits signs of aging, and increases cellular regeneration; it helps control blemishes and breakouts & hydrates skin. It has been researched for its antioxidant and anti-inflammatory properties. There are many conditions that may be used for treatment, including congestive heart failure, high blood pressure, hepatitis, high cholesterol, and cystic fibrosis. Taurine is also frequently used for its antioxidant properties to prevent cell-damaging side effects of chemotherapy. It may help reduce oxidative stress, insomnia, psychosis, and anemia.
L-Glutathione (Glutathione)
L-Glutathione (Glutathione) is a powerful tripeptide antioxidant comprised of amino acids cysteine, glycine, and glutamic acid. Glutathione has many functions. It is vital to mitochondrial function and necessary for DNA synthesis. Glutathione’s ability to neutralize free radicals and bind to harsh toxins makes it essential for detoxification and healthy immune function. Glutathione’s antioxidant properties may also promote cellular health by removing oxidative stressors. Although glutathione is naturally produced in the body, levels can decline over time. Supplementation with glutathione may support longevity and vitality in those with glutathione deficiencies. It is key in supporting immune function, metabolism, sperm cell formation, tissue building and repair, and certain enzyme functions.
Ondansetron
Ondansetron is a selective 5-HT3 receptor antagonist that acts both centrally and peripherally to prevent and treat nausea and vomiting. Centrally, it works by blocking and/or antagonizing serotonin receptors in the brain that mediate the sensation of nausea. Peripherally, ondansetron works through the vagus nerve, which can sense nausea and vomiting triggers in the GI tract.
Ascorbic Acid (Vitamin C)
Plays an important role in the body: it protects the body’s cells from damage. It is also necessary to maintain the health of skin, teeth, bone, cartilage, and blood vessels. Studies have shown that it may help brain function in people with cognitive impairments such as Alzheimer’s disease and dementia. Without the proper amount of ascorbic acid, people are at risk for cardiovascular illness, compromised immune systems, premature aging, increased stress response, and low energy. Ascorbic acid is found in foods such as citrus fruits, kiwi, broccoli, tomatoes, leafy vegetables, potatoes, Brussels sprouts, raw bell peppers, and strawberries. Most people get sufficient ascorbic acid through their diet. Others may not be able to absorb enough through diet or ingestible supplements. Ascorbic acid is one of many antioxidants that can protect against damage caused by harmful molecules called free radicals, as well as toxic chemicals and pollutants like cigarette smoke. Free radicals can build up and contribute to the development of health conditions such as cancer, heart disease, and arthritis. Ascorbic acid may also be beneficial for patients with colds, macular degeneration, inflammation, skin aging, and those who have suffered from a stroke.
Vitamin B Complex (B1, B2, B3, B5, B6)
This mixture is packed with B-complex vitamins, which may help keep skin and blood cells healthy and convert nutrients into energy. Helps reduce excess fatigue caused by dehydration, helps reduce physiologic response to stress, reduces tension throughout the body, and reduces inflammation. Thiamine (B1): Improves your immune system and helps convert fat and carbs into energy. Niacinamide (B3): Eases inflammation and can help maintain healthy-looking skin. Riboflavin (B2): Increases metabolism and supports your immune system. Dexpanthenol (B5): Essential for maintaining healthy skin, hair, eyes, and liver. Pyridoxine (B6): Promotes red blood cell production and converts food into energy.
Zinc
Zinc is used to help reduce the duration of illnesses, prevent infection and speed up the body’s healing process. It is an essential mineral naturally occurring in the body. It’s crucial for the growth and maintenance of healthy body tissues. As a result of its anti-inflammatory properties, zinc plays a large role in helping facilitate the healing of wounds and burns. Studies have also demonstrated its value with illnesses; research suggests that zinc supplementation in the early stages of the common cold may reduce the duration of the illness. Because of its anti-inflammatory properties, zinc may be beneficial in protocols designed with skin conditions such as acne and eczema in mind. Additionally, studies suggest proper zinc levels may be beneficial in improving sexual function and testosterone levels in postmenopausal women.
Magnesium Chloride
Magnesium Chloride reduces fatigue, improves immunity, improves relaxation, and more. Magnesium Chloride is a highly soluble form of magnesium, an essential mineral that is important in maintaining the function of the nervous, skeletal, and muscular systems. It plays an integral role in the synthesis of energy within cells, creating DNA, and supporting bone density. Magnesium can help regulate cellular calcium levels, making it a key player in heart health and bone strength. It relaxes uterine muscle spasms, reduces prostaglandin production to decrease pain and inflammation, and aids with head/migraine pain. As an essential mineral, magnesium chloride infusions may be beneficial to patients with magnesium deficiencies. Often referred to as “the relaxation mineral,” magnesium is often employed in regimens that aim to lower stress and anxiety and promote healthier sleep.

Glutamine
Glutamine is an amino acid. Amino acids play many roles within the body. Their main purpose is to serve as building blocks for proteins. Glutamine is the most abundant free amino acid in the body. It is produced in the muscles and distributed via the bloodstream. Glutamine provides the necessary nitrogen and carbon to fuel a variety of cell processes. It is also essential to the production of some amino acids and glucose. Because of this, glutamine plays a key role in fueling the body’s natural healing processes and healthy organ function. The body can usually synthesize sufficient amounts of glutamine, but in some instances of stress, such as after a traumatic injury or illness, the body’s demand for glutamine increases and can outpace the amount the muscles can produce on their own. Additional glutamine can be obtained from the diet. Glutamine is found in protein-rich sources such as beef, chicken, fish, dairy products, eggs, beans, beets, cabbage, spinach, carrots, parsley, vegetable juices, wheat, papaya, Brussels sprouts, celery, kale, and fermented foods like miso. Maintaining adequate levels of glutamine is critical to maintaining a healthy immune system and supporting the body’s ability to heal itself. It may help muscles recover faster after intense workouts. It can help reduce recovery time for wounds and burns. It may improve symptoms of IBS, leaky gut, and ulcers. Glutamine is a precursor to glutamate, which could help with brain issues such as Reye’s Syndrome, epilepsy, anxiety, depression, and addiction.
Carnitine
Carnitine is found in nearly all cells of the body and plays a critical role in the production of energy. It transports long-chain fatty acids into the mitochondria so they can be oxidized, or burned, to produce energy. Carnitine also transports toxic compounds out of the cellular organelles, preventing any accumulation. Given these functions, carnitine is concentrated in tissues that utilize fatty acids as fuel, like skeletal and cardiac muscles. For most people, the body makes enough carnitine. However, some people have genetic or medical conditions that prevent their bodies from meeting the necessary amount. This is when oral or injected supplementation is essential. Carnitine occurs in two forms: D-carnitine and L-carnitine. They are isomers (or mirror images) of each other. L-carnitine is the active form found in the body that transports fat to cells to be used as fuel in metabolic processes. D-carnitine does not occur naturally in humans. L-carnitine is synthesized in the brain, liver, and kidneys from the amino acids methionine and lysine and is critical to heart and brain function, muscle movement, and several other body processes. Insufficient carnitine can lead to problems in the liver, heart, and muscles. It helps turn fat into energy, which makes it an ideal supplement for fitness goals. L-Carnitine may help reduce muscle damage during resistance training.
